Bill Text: NY S02027 | 2011-2012 | General Assembly | Introduced


Bill Title: Requires public housing authorities to install and maintain a functioning carbon monoxide detector in each of its tenant dwelling units, excluding units whose sole source of heat is electric heat.

Spectrum: Partisan Bill (Democrat 1-0)

Status: (Introduced - Dead) 2011-01-18 - REFERRED TO HOUSING, CONSTRUCTION AND COMMUNITY DEVELOPMENT [S02027 Detail]

       AN  ACT to amend the public housing law, in relation to required instal-
         lation of carbon monoxide detectors
         THE PEOPLE OF THE STATE OF NEW YORK, REPRESENTED IN SENATE AND  ASSEM-
       BLY, DO ENACT AS FOLLOWS:
    1    Section  1.  The public housing law is amended by adding a new section
    2  152-a to read as follows:
    3    S 152-A. SAFETY REQUIREMENTS; CARBON MONOXIDE DETECTORS. EACH AUTHORI-
    4  TY SHALL INSTALL AND MAINTAIN A FUNCTIONING CARBON MONOXIDE DETECTOR  IN
    5  EVERY  TENANT DWELLING UNIT, EXCLUDING THOSE DWELLING UNITS HAVING ELEC-
    6  TRIC HEAT AS THEIR SOLE SOURCE OF HEAT.
    7    S 2. This act shall take effect on the first of October next  succeed-
    8  ing the date on which it shall have become a law.
